Painting Description
"Blumenpokal Auf Balustrade" is a distinguished still life painting by the renowned French artist Jean-Baptiste Monnoyer, who was active during the late 17th and early 18th centuries. Monnoyer, born in 1636 in Lille, France, is celebrated for his exquisite floral compositions that combine meticulous detail with a sense of opulence and grandeur. His works are often characterized by their lush, vibrant depictions of flowers, arranged in elaborate and often fantastical bouquets.
In "Blumenpokal Auf Balustrade," Monnoyer showcases his exceptional skill in rendering a diverse array of flowers with remarkable precision and lifelike quality. The painting features a lavish bouquet set in an ornate vase, placed on a balustrade, which adds a sense of architectural elegance to the composition. The flowers, rendered in a rich palette of colors, include roses, tulips, peonies, and other blooms, each meticulously detailed to highlight their unique textures and forms. The arrangement is both harmonious and dynamic, capturing the viewer's attention with its intricate interplay of light and shadow.
Monnoyer's ability to infuse his floral arrangements with a sense of movement and vitality is evident in this work. The careful placement of each flower and the subtle gradations of color create a sense of depth and realism that draws the viewer into the scene. The balustrade, with its classical design, serves as a stable yet elegant base for the exuberant display of nature's beauty.
"Blumenpokal Auf Balustrade" exemplifies Monnoyer's mastery of the still life genre and his contribution to the Baroque period's artistic legacy. His work not only celebrates the beauty of flowers but also reflects the era's fascination with nature and the decorative arts. Today, Monnoyer's paintings are highly regarded for their artistic excellence and continue to be admired by art enthusiasts and scholars alike.
